Dan Osborn for U.S. Senate is hiring a Political Associate to build and mobilize relationships with elected officials, community leaders, and stakeholder organizations across Nebraska in one of the most closely watched Senate races in the country. This role supports the campaign's statewide political engagement strategy, working closely with the Political Director to strengthen coalitions and drive grassroots activation. The ideal candidate is relationship-oriented, highly organized, and eager to learn the mechanics of campaign politics and coalition building. This position reports to the Campaign Manager.

Responsibilities will include:

  • Supporting the Political Director in implementing the campaign's statewide political engagement strategy
  • Identifying, researching, and engaging elected officials, community leaders, labor and agricultural organizations, and coalition partners to strengthen the campaign's network across Nebraska
  • Tracking endorsements and key relationships in coordination with the political and field teams
  • Communicating key updates, resources, and engagement opportunities to partners and supporters
  • Supporting the planning and execution of political and community events, including roundtables, meet-and-greets, and local gatherings
  • Briefing and coordinating surrogates and staff who represent the campaign at political or community events
  • Assisting in staffing and organizing phone banks, text banks, and other grassroots outreach efforts
  • Attending and staffing campaign events statewide, ensuring smooth logistics and timely follow-up
  • Overseeing and delegating VAN access and training as needed
  • Collaborating with the communications, digital, and field teams to align messaging and outreach
  • Partnering with the organizing team to integrate political outreach into volunteer recruitment and voter contact efforts
  • Ensuring accurate, timely sharing of political engagement updates across campaign departments

Qualifications:

  • Experience in campaigns, government, advocacy, or community organizing preferred but not required.
  • Excellent communication and relationship-building skills with diverse stakeholders.
  • Strong organizational and research skills with attention to detail.
  • Proficiency with Google Suite; familiarity with NGP/VAN a plus.
  • Valid driver's license, reliable transportation, and availability for extensive in-state travel.
  • Passion for grassroots politics and public service
  • Comfortable working long, irregular hours, including evenings and weekends.

This is a full-time, in-person position based in Nebraska, requiring extensive in-state travel, that will end when the campaign concludes in November 2026. You will collaborate with colleagues based across Nebraska. Campaign hours are expected of any successful candidate.

This is a salaried position compensated between $4,000 and $5,500 per month, based on experience. Moving expenses will be reimbursed for candidates from outside of Nebraska.
